Product Parameters
Type L/D Main Power(kw) Screw Diameter(mm) Screw Speed (rpm) Output(kg/h)
MSI20 11~30:1 3 20 120 0.5~3
MSI25 11~33:1 4 25 120 0.5~5
MSI30 11~36:1 5.5 30 120 0.5~7
MSI35 11~36:1 7.5 35 120 0.5~10

Advantages of a Single Screw Extruder

Simple structure, one-step procurement cost

  • The significant reduction in single-screw structural components results in lower manufacturing costs, which directly translates into a more competitive overall machine price.

Zero threshold for operation

  • Usually equipped with a frequency conversion speed adjustment knob and a digital temperature control display, the operator simply needs to set the desired speed and temperature for each stage, pour in the pre-mixed wet material, and the granules can be produced continuously.
  • Maximum temperature: 350℃ (optional 450℃)    Temperature control accuracy ±1℃

Low energy consumption and simple maintenance

  • The motor power of a single-screw granulator is typically only 60% to 70% of that of a twin-screw granulator of the same specification, resulting in a considerable difference in electricity costs for long-term operation.
  • In terms of maintenance, the screw and barrel are the main wear parts, but their replacement cycle is long, and the disassembly and assembly steps are few, which can be completed by ordinary mechanics without relying on long-distance visits from original factory engineers.

High yield rate of good pellets

  • A granulation rate of ≥95% indicates that almost all of the input raw materials are converted into effective finished products, with minimal waste on screening and rework. The uniform diameter and controllable length of the molded particles are silent competitive advantages.

Strong adaptability

  • Whether it’s powdered activated carbon with added binder, filter cake-like catalyst, or kneaded wet food additive material, or feed raw material mixed with additives, all can be extruded into regular pellets.
